Output 17e451087ec4ebc067d9dc99b9c29d8b906b6e30e5ada7e004883553c8fe8808:5

value
4999040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8335f6d63c2f8fa0787d566de43e32d06e5b959 OP_EQUAL
address
3MQBRRPQ1ndudRWo6iwExq5xxVfqnupscb
transaction
17e451087ec4ebc067d9dc99b9c29d8b906b6e30e5ada7e004883553c8fe8808
spent
true